As semi-promised, here are some more training camp cuts as announced by the D-Fenders. In turn: didn't expect N'Doye to make the team, as he (like Skemp in Erie) came into camp as the third center; Moore has bounced around other minor leagues and overseas, so the fact that he didn't stick here wasn't much of a surprise either; like N'Doye, there wasn't much room for Pinick behind Deron Washington and Ryan Forehan-Kelly, even though he's a smart player who will likely do pretty well overseas; Wise showed he could score in college, but the team already has a lot of those guys, particularly after acquiring Dar Tucker; speaking of which, I know Pruitt was injured, but this leaves the team with one real point guard, a Mr. Horace Wormely, who was first team all-NAIA in college but is also 5'6".
